Hyundai Venue: Floor Console / Floor Console Assembly. Repair procedures

Hyundai Venue (QX) (2020-2025) Service Manual / Body (Interior and Exterior) / Floor Console / Floor Console Assembly. Repair procedures

Replacement
Hyundai Venue. Floor Console Assembly. Repair procedures   
Put on gloves to prevent hand injuries.
When removing with a flat-tip screwdriver or remover, wrap protective tape around the tools to prevent damage to components.
Use a plastic panel removal tool to remove interior trim pieces without marring the surface.
Take care not to bend or scratch the trim and panels.
1.
Remove the gear knob & gear boots (A) pull both of it up.

Hyundai Venue. Floor Console Assembly. Repair procedures

Hyundai Venue. Floor Console Assembly. Repair procedures

2.
Using a remover and remove the console upper cover (A).

Hyundai Venue. Floor Console Assembly. Repair procedures

3.
Press the lock pin and separate the various connectors (A).

Hyundai Venue. Floor Console Assembly. Repair procedures

4.
Remove the storage box pad (A).

Hyundai Venue. Floor Console Assembly. Repair procedures

5.
Remove the parking brake cover (A).

Hyundai Venue. Floor Console Assembly. Repair procedures

6.
Loosen the mounting bolts and remove the rear console assembly (A).

Hyundai Venue. Floor Console Assembly. Repair procedures

7.
Loosen the mounting screws, clips and remove the front console assembly (A).

Hyundai Venue. Floor Console Assembly. Repair procedures

8.
To install, reverse removal procedure.
Hyundai Venue. Floor Console Assembly. Repair procedures   
Make sure the connector is connected properly.
Replace any damaged clips (or pin-type retainers).
